Taxi Vehicle Age Policy

Summary

...to approve increasing the entry age for licensed vehicles to nine years (subject to Euro 6 emissions standards), increasing the renewal age to 15 years, increasing mid-term inspections for vehicles over 11 years old, and reducing inspections for vehicles under three years old, with implementation as soon as reasonably practicable.

Purpose

To determine the age
policy for licensed vehicles.

Decision

To aprove that:
 

i)         
The entry age for licensed vehicles to be increased from five years
to nine years, subject to vehicles meeting Euro 6 emissions
standards as a minimum,
 

ii)         The
renewal age for licensed vehicles to be increased from 11 years to
15 years,
 

iii)        The number of
planned mid-term vehicle inspections for vehicles over the age of
11 to be increased from two to three (ie, every four months),
and
 

iv)       
The number of planned inspections for vehicles under the age of
three to be reduced from two to one.
           
v)        
Implementation as soon as reasonably practicable.
